Trump Is Terrifying Again at Another Rally

At a campaign rally last night in Montoursville, Pennsylvania, Donald Trump oversaw a crowd that chanted for his political opponents to be jailed not once but three times, and then "joked" about serving five terms as president.

The crowd first booed Hillary Clinton and chanted "Lock her up!" which is a feature of virtually every single one of his rallies; and then randomly yelled "Lock them up!" during a break in his speech; and finally chanted "Lock them up!" in response to Trump accusing the FBI and Democrats of treason.

And then there was this, stuck in the middle of his usual authoritarian, nativist, and otherwise reprehensible rantings:

Now we're gonna have a second time, and we're gonna have another one, and then we'll drive them crazy, let me— Ready? [the crowd cheers]

And maybe if we really like it a lot, and if things keep going like they're going, we'll go and do what we have to do — we'll do a three and a four and a five! Watch — they'll have tomorrow "We knew he—" [waves hand and chuckles] I don't want to say it. [crowd laughs]

No, we're gonna have another one, and it's gonna be great, and, you know, one of the things we're talking about, the greatest, probably, I think, political slogan of all time is what you have on your hats: Make America Great Again.
Donald Trump always telegraphs what he is planning to do, often under the auspices of a "joke."

This is not a joke. The President of the United States is suggesting that he will ignore the law on term limits and "do what we have to do" to continue to stay in office for as long as 20 years.
